9.2.1 Centrifugal Pump
This is a radial machine in which fluid enter at its center and comes out from the periphery of a rotating element impeller. Side view of a centrifugal compressor having volute casting is shown in Fig.9.2.1(a)along with the nomenclature of its different parts. Impeller is made of a hub on which number of vanes are casted at equiangular position either on its one or bolt faces making passage for the fluid to glide through it for which the curvature of vanes is so designed that fluid flows without separation. Pump is known as single or double suction pump accordingly. A double suction pump is used where large mass flow rate is required. A shaft connects hub to motor and passes through the pump casing, which provides bearing for the shaft, see Fig.9.2.1(b). Seal is provided between casing and pump shaft to stop leakage od fluid.
